The only difference is the lack of SAS controller. If you want to build now, go ahead and order it, the V1 is great. The only issue is running RAID simultaneously on the SAS controller and the SATA controller. There is some performance bottleneck when both controllers try to run RAID. From the sounds of it, it was an architectural mistake, so they removed the SAS controller. Otherwise, the boards are the same.

The actual Part # from the box for the V1 is: 90-MIB600-G0AAY00Z
I'm looking for the Part # of the V2, but so far I don't know anyone that has one. I would agree with not going through BzBoys, with the newer tech, I'd stick to one of the larger retailers like NewEgg or Amazon.
